內容簡介 Edited by Sharon Darrow and including nearly ninety poets from across the United States and Canada, The Country in the Mirror: Poems of Protest & Witness is an urgent anthology of poems written in response to the troubles of our times. It is comprised of a variety of voices, from new writers to well-seasoned poets who are widely published and celebrated, such as Martín Espada, Nikki Grimes, Rachel Hadas, Gregory Maguire, Bianca Stone, among others, writing about a myriad of issues related to immigration, detention, loss of voice, civil rights, climate change, rising fascism, global wars, genocide, abortion, LGBTQIA+ experiences and more. The Country in the Mirror holds a mirror to our diversity, our freedom of expression, and our collective humanity to remind us of the liberties we have as Americans, and to caution of their loss.
